Credit card spending falls again
Spending on credit cards fell in August, according to the British Bankers Association (BBA).

It is the second time this year that monthly spending on credit cards has dropped.

The BBA said the fall reflected very weak retail sales and consumers being cautious about their spending.

A report from the banking industry earlier this month highlighted the long term decline in the popularity of credit cards.
